Theory Colloquium

Binary black hole systems in a non-relativistic effective theory

by Andreas Maier (DESY Zeuthen)

Description

In the advent of gravitational wave astronomy, precise and flexible theoretical descriptions will be instrumental to analyse the characteristics of compact binary systems. I review recent progress in the calculation of non-relativistic corrections in the framework of an effective field theory, based on techniques adopted from particle physics.
